Wood siding replacement services involve removing damaged or deteriorated exterior wood panels and installing new siding to restore the appearance and integrity of a property’s exterior. This process typically includes inspecting the existing siding for issues such as rot, warping, or insect damage, followed by carefully removing the compromised materials. The replacement siding is then installed to match the existing style or to update the look of the property, often involving sealing and finishing to ensure durability against weather elements.
These services address common problems associated with aging or poorly maintained wood siding, such as moisture infiltration, pest infestations, and structural deterioration. Over time, wood siding can become warped, cracked, or rotten, which not only impacts curb appeal but also poses risks to the underlying structure. Replacing damaged siding helps prevent further issues by providing a protective barrier that maintains the building’s stability and reduces the likelihood of costly repairs down the line.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for wood siding replacement varies, typically ranging from $2 to $10 per square foot, depending on the type of wood chosen. Higher-end woods like cedar or redwood tend to be more expensive. Local pros can provide specific estimates based on material selection.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for replacing wood siding generally fall between $1.50 and $4 per square foot. Factors influencing this include the complexity of the installation and the condition of the existing structure. Contact local service providers for detailed quotes.
Total Project Cost - Overall expenses for wood siding replacement can range from $3.50 to $14 per square foot, combining materials and labor. Larger projects or high-end materials may increase the total cost. Local contractors can help determine precise pricing based on project scope.
Additional Charges - Additional costs may include removal and disposal of old siding, which can add $1 to $3 per square foot. Other factors like surface preparation or repairs can also influence the final price. Local pros can assess these potential charges during consultations.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
